Abstract

The aim of this study to examine the role of Work-Family Conflict (WFC) and Workplace Spirituality in predicting Organizational Citizenship Behavior (OCB). 121 teachers participated in this research.Instruments used in this study are OCB (Podsakof, 1980), Work Family Conflict Scale (Carlson et al, 2000) and Wokplace Spiritulity Scale ( Asmos & Dunchon, 2000). Multiple regression analysis is used to analyzed the data. Results indicated that Work Family Conflict and Workplace Spirituality predict OCB with value R2 = 40.2%, F (2.97), 32.652, P <0.01, in which 40.2% OCB predicted by WorkFamily Conflict and Workplace Spirituality, while 59.8% influenced by other factors . Result shows that, WFC negatively corelate with OCB and Workplace Spirituality shows greater correlation in predicting OCB in compare to WFC. Kindergarten teacher show highest OCB and workplace spirituality in compare to elementary and junior high school teachers. However, there is no significant different in term of WFC across demographic. Therefore, schools are expected to create policies and intervention programs that can reduce Work-Family Conflict and improve Workplace Spirituality to promote a better Organizational Citizenship Behavior among teachers.
